Huawei Tanzania
Huawei Tanzania commits itself to increasing connectivity and accelerating digital inclusion across the country for the realization of the Tanzania Development Vision 2025.
Since entered Tanzania in 2007, Huawei has provided its clients with end-to-end ICT solutions for secure, reliable, resilient and efficient operations of communications networks in the country. In addition, it has introduced advanced digital applications and services to the country and devoted itself to knowledge and skill transfer, to make ICT more available,accessible and affordable to Tanzanians.

Boosting ICT infrastructure
By rolling out networks consists of data center, fiber and base stations, Huawei Tanzania works with its partners in connecting Tanzanians from different regions of the country, closing digital gap and laying solid foundation for sustainable socio-economic development.
- Upgrading Tanzania’s network from 2G all the way to 4G with operators.
- Building optical fiber broadband network that connects all 26 regions in Tanzania.
- Connecting over 2 million people living in rural areas with operators.
- Introducing Mobile Money services to Tanzania with operators, achieving 27 million subscriptions nationwide.
- Providing efficient and reliable wireless communications system for SGR in Tanzania.

Promoting knowledge transfer
Huawei Tanzania is committed to ICT knowledge and skill transfer to Tanzanians to cultivate a healthy ICT ecosystem in Tanzania and build a digital talent pool needed for sustainable development in partnership with industrial and academic partners.
- Huawei Tanzania has upskilled over 2000 ICT engineers and civil servants over the past 14 years.
- Establishing 14 ICT academies with top universities in Tanzania and providing certification programs to 4000 Tanzanian students.
- 4000+ Tanzanian students registered for Huawei ICT competition since 2018. In 2020, 3 Tanzanian university students have emerged as winners of the first prize at Huawei ICT Competition sub-Saharan Africa regional finals and 3 others scooped the second prize at global finals.
- Since 2016, around 100 Tanzanian students have benefited from Huawei’s Seeds for the Future program.

Creating a dynamic ICT ecosystem
Working with local business partners, most of which are SMEs, Huawei Tanzania integrates local businesses into global value chains.
- Working with 50+ local business partners.
- Total worth of Huawei Tanzania’s local purchases for the last three years reaches 27 million USD.
- Huawei Tanzania works to ensure sustainable development by offering its employees with equal opportunities to work, learn and develop, so that they can grow together with the company and achieve shared success.
- As a responsible corporate citizen, Huawei Tanzania keeps giving back to society with various CSR programs
